Experience Details

Kagoshima, located in the southernmost part of Japan’s mainland, is famous for their local spirits made from sweet potato, with around 114 shochu distilleries and over 2000 brands of shochu in Kagoshima. At the southern tip of Kagoshima, you’ll find Meijigura Distillery, housed in a historic 100-year-old building, which still uses traditional shochu production methods.
